Adamson begs off from Filoil bronze game, takes on UV in Surigao


There won’t be a bronze medal game in the 2022 Filoil Ecooil Preseason Cup on Saturday.

Adamson University has begged off from competing in the third place match as it has a prior commitment.

The Soaring Falcons are headed to San Agustin, Surigao del Sur this weekend as they will take on the University of Visayas Green Lancers in an exhibition game setup by Vice Governor Mangi Alameda.

Adamson has that game penciled in for a month already.

The Soaring Falcons were dealt a heartbreak by National University on Thursday, falling 70-71 in overtime.

With this, De La Salle University, who lost to Far Eastern University in the other bracket — 67-71 in overtime, will automatically gain third place.

The winner-take-all clash between the Bulldogs and the Tamaraws will still push through at 5:00 PM.
